Where is the air filter in a 2014 Lexus GS 450h?

  • The engine air filter sits in the intake housing near the front of the engine bay; the cabin filter is located behind the glovebox or under the cowl.

How often should I change the engine air filter on my 2014 Lexus GS 450h?

  • Typical intervals are every 15,000–30,000 miles depending on driving conditions; we inspect the filter at every service visit and recommend replacement when it affects performance or fuel economy.

What is the difference between an engine air filter and a cabin air filter?

  • Engine air filters protect the engine and performance; cabin air filters protect occupants from pollen, dust, and pollutants. Both are essential for longevity and comfort.

What are signs of a bad air filter?

  • Reduced acceleration, lower fuel economy, unusual engine sounds, or poor HVAC airflow indicate inspection is needed; our certified technicians diagnose and advise on cost-effective solutions.
